So there I was selling bikinis out of my truck in South Beach Miami, getting ready to kick off a wet t-shirt contest when the world’s biggest grouch approached me – Keller Fitzwilliam.

The man had the sultriest British accent I’ve ever heard. And he looked like he just walked off a Viking boat and into a suit tailored specifically for his impressively muscular frame. Only problem is, he had the warmth of an ice pick and he kept telling me he was here to take me back to his home country.

Of course, I didn’t follow him. I might be up for a good time, but I’m also educated enough to know leaving with a stranger isn’t smart. Well, that’s until he mentioned my mom’s name. My mom who passed away several years ago.

So after some serious fact-checking, my bikini-clad bum went with him to a sub-arctic country I had never heard of just north of the British Isles, where I found out my grandpa was the king of said freezing country, and I was the one and only heir.

Desperate to learn more about my mom, I decided to give this princess thing a chance. Good idea, right? Wrong.

Because Mr. Ice Pick was put to the task of training me and he’s not just cold as ice, he’s pompous, aggravating, and possessive. And did I mention we have to share a bathroom in a tiny castle? We are oil and water every single day and even though he’s training me to be queen, I have this simmering desire to kneel before him.

As always I am here for all the RomCom smooze Meghan Quinn can offer me and Royally Not Ready was just the right amount of chuckles and swoon I needed this weekend. So here we go…

Up first, Lily, our amazingly awkward and sexually word vomit heroine. She is quirky and fun, though her dialogue semi-goes from being an actual adult to almost a childish personality which irked me from time to time but her playful attitude was definitely where most of the entertainment came from while Keller was the overly broody man meat. He was rather charming, and after putting up with Lily’s passive aggressive approach, he is a saint.

Their romance was a massive push and pull for sure. There was some constant boundary crossing but in a fun way. They had an instant connection that Lily is constantly trying to get Keller to admit but ultimately they do start to form a comfortable bond. There were still some moments where I felt their sexual tension was more so forced than just a natural evolution but I do think most of that was caused by Lily, she did not accept no for an answer. Both interesting and yet still a bit too much.

Bottom line, Royally Not Ready was absolutely a fun read. Meghan Quinn always creates such amazing characters in both the main characters and the supporting characters. The romance was delicious, the drama was believable, and the ending was perfection. And even though the ‘rags to riches’ with enemies to lovers type tropes but this was such a fun read with all kinds of twists and turns. I was either drooling from sexual tension or laughing full force until my chest hurt.
